Creating a safe and profitable space for the mass-production of food is critical.   Each individual brand must put a premium on protecting the quality and safety of their product while meeting demand.

Precast concrete is a natural fit for facilities like these. Custom-engineered components for floors, walls, stairs, columns, beams, and roofs are combined to provide a long-lasting structure that maximizes the controlled space within and carries the load for necessaries like machines, conveyor belts, forklifts, and people.   In addition to their inherent sustainability, precast structures can feature an interior finish that meets food-grade standards as well: smooth, clean, and impenetrable.   There is also a variety of finishes and colors for an attractive façade.   The structure can blend with its surroundings or be as beautiful as desired!

Custom Precast Concrete Options

With precast concrete, the client can be creative by balancing aesthetics with value.   Shapes, sizes and thicknesses can be customized, while Value Engineering can be achieved by utilizing modular, standard, precast products.   Exterior finishes can use any combination of exposed aggregates, a smooth substrate to receive paint, cast-in thin brick, or abrasive blast.   A pleasing aesthetic can be achieved while still maintaining precast concrete’s intrinsic benefits: durability, strength, sound attenuation, and energy efficiency.
